+// -*- C++ -*-
+//===----------------------------------------------------------------------===//
+//
+// Part of the BastionOS freestanding C++ standard library.
+//
+// tuple_size and tuple_element — protocol types for structured bindings.
+// Primary templates here; specializations in pair.h, array, tuple.h, etc.
+//
+//===----------------------------------------------------------------------===//
+
+#ifndef _LIBBASTION_TUPLE_TUPLE_ELEMENT_H
+#define _LIBBASTION_TUPLE_TUPLE_ELEMENT_H
+
+#include <__config>
+#include <cstddef>
+
+_LIBBASTION_BEGIN_NAMESPACE_STD
+
+// Primary templates (specialized by pair, array, tuple, variant).
+template<class _Tp>
+struct tuple_size; // : integral_constant<size_t, N>
+
+template<class _Tp>
+struct tuple_size<const _Tp> : tuple_size<_Tp> {};
+
+template<class _Tp>
+inline constexpr size_t tuple_size_v = tuple_size<_Tp>::value;
+
+template<size_t _Ip, class _Tp>
+struct tuple_element; // { using type = ...; }
+
+template<size_t _Ip, class _Tp>
+struct tuple_element<_Ip, const _Tp> {
+ using type = const typename tuple_element<_Ip, _Tp>::type;
+};
+
+template<size_t _Ip, class _Tp>
+using tuple_element_t = typename tuple_element<_Ip, _Tp>::type;
+
+_LIBBASTION_END_NAMESPACE_STD
+
+#endif // _LIBBASTION_TUPLE_TUPLE_ELEMENT_H
